Katie Melua - Two Bare Feet

Katie Melua releases Two Bare Feet, an up-tempo good-time pop song with catchy brass and piano licks that challenge you not to tap your feet.

Two Bare Feet is one of three new songs recorded for the release of The Katie Melua Collection, a musical summary of the 24 year old's journey so far, which is being released to coincide with Katie's arena tour in October and November 2008. This two disc set comprises 17 songs - including The Closest Thing To Crazy, Nine Million Bicycles, the number 1 duet with Eva Cassidy What A Wonderful World and 3 previously unreleased bonus tracks - and a live DVD filmed earlier this year in Rotterdam.

Highlights from Katie's three albums (Call Off The Search, Piece By Piece and Pictures) are joined by When You Taught Me How To Dance, from the film Miss Potter, and the three new songs recorded for this album release - Toy Collection (written by Katie for the MySpace film Faintheart), Somewhere In The Same Hotel (a slow, bluesy song co-written by Katie and Mike) and Two Bare Feet (a brand new, up-tempo, foot-tapping Katie/Mike co-write).
